Tackle, Gear & Other Info

Gear

Jackets, Waders and Boots off

Due to the diverse weather conditions we face in the Patagonia, we suggest you bring the following clothing:

  1. Good quality Gore-tex® (or other breathable material) jacket for wind and rain protection
  2. Breathable, stocking-foot waders with high-grade, felt-soled wading boots with good ankle support for walking on uneven terrain
  3. Wading staffs for balance and support
  4. Wading belts for added buoyancy and safety


Spiked boots are best left home as they are hard on the floors of our rafts and boats.

Clothing Recommendations

Proper clothing and packing are very important for your trip. Keep in mind the airline allows two bags per person, so packing equipment and gear efficiently is important.
